Monster Hunter Series

The Monster Hunter Series is a franchise of action role-playing video games developed and published by Capcom. The core gameplay involves players taking on the role of hunters, who are tasked with tracking and defeating a variety of giant monsters in diverse environments. This series emphasizes strategic combat, cooperative multiplayer gameplay, and the collection of materials dropped by defeated monsters, which can be used to craft weapons, armor, and items. Players often engage in quests, explore vast landscapes, and utilize various weapons and tactics to succeed in their hunts. The series is known for its intricate mechanics, deep customization options, and a dedicated fan base. The first game was released in 2004, and it has since expanded to include multiple sequels, spin-offs, and adaptations across various platforms.
